    I had a very pleasant dinner at Ristorante Flaiano, which is located in the old part of the town.
    The host is from Apulia (south of Italy), but all the dishes served are from Abruzzo.
    The ambience is very cosy, with many pictures of Italian movies of the 60's.
    The restaurant started its activity at the beginning of 2007, but locals seem to enjoy it a lot, since the restaurant was fully booked even though it was Monday night.

    We started with some bruschette (bread with tomatos, olive oil, tartufo mushroom, ricotta cheese), which were very tasty.
    My parents then went on with a tagliata di angus (beef) with porcini mushroom. I tried it and I must say it was really excellent! I took farro with porcini and pumpking as main course, it was excellent too and very healthy also.
    As dessert, we chose a delicious chocolate tart with hot chocolate filling inside.

    Every dish was well prepared - see my pics for more details.

    Price: less than 25 € each. A great deal!!

  • This restaurant/enoteca (=wine tasting) is located in the old part of town. The ambience is very cosy and typical Italian, with a wide choice of kinds of wine. The restaurant has many tables and can host many guests but it is spread into many different rooms.
    The host is from Salamanca (Spain), so you will find many Spanish dishes in the menu (e.g. Jamon Serrano), beside some international ones (e.g. meat imported from Argentina) and of course from Abruzzo.

    We decided to take only a main course. My parents chose tagliatelle (home made pasta) with porcini mushroom (a must in Autumn!) and I took home made gnocchi with zenzero. All dishes served were tasty and delicious. We had some chocolate as dessert. My parents tried a local wine (little expensive - 3 euros per glass) and they enjoyed it a lot. The wine list was of course very very long.

    We spent 18 euros each.

    I noticed that prices in Abruzzo are much lower than in the north of Italy, and food is always fresh and genuine. A great experience - would come back again!

  • The seafood there is really fresh. You must try the range of antipasta there. Most of the dishes I tried were raw and it brought out the freshness of the sea. Try the midget crabs, oysters, prawns and panocchie o cicale. I didnt really try the full first plate as I was filled to the brim at the end of the antipasta display.

    Panocchie o cicale. Sweet and soft. Must be eaten raw....
